- The distance between Wilmington, De, Usa and Newberry, Sc, Usa is approximately 848 km or 527 mi.
- To reach Wilmington, De in this distance one would set out from Newberry, Sc bearing 40.3°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Wilmington, De bearing 44.1° or NE .
- Both have a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Wilmington, De is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Newberry, Sc is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 4.6 °C (8.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.9 °C (8.8°F) more in Wilmington, De.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 197.8 mm (7.8 in) less which is equivalent to 197.8 l/m² (4.85 US gal/ft²) or 1,978,000 l/ha (211,461 US gal/ac) less. About 5/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.7° lower in Wilmington, De than in Newberry, Sc.
